Output 84586bb6f20cb98f57c031a03aa5098cc023492915ccad30568883a92a9b95d7:1

value
221310512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7241e5ca6de613e4e2781f2951aec2f2b2bd0ced OP_EQUAL
address
3C79u4PrMSg173hEHDrpk58cJkmYg2z15n
transaction
84586bb6f20cb98f57c031a03aa5098cc023492915ccad30568883a92a9b95d7
confirmations
352577
spent
true